update-user-activity

Update a user's current activity

Auth

Self

Example

pearing-cli update-user-activity --activity "Working on mentions"

Expected Response

Updates the activity resource and prints the updated JSON object. Omit TARGET_USERNAME to update yourself, pass --activity=- to read from stdin, or use --clear to clear the current activity.

Errors

  • 400 Bad Request for invalid activity values.
  • 404 Not Found when the target user does not exist.
  • 409 Conflict for state conflicts.

Common auth errors are documented on the CLI overview page.

Help Output

Update a user's current activity.

Updates only the activity field on an existing user. The target
must be the authenticated user.

Examples:

  update-user-activity --activity "Working on mentions"
  update-user-activity alice --activity "Reviewing thread 151"
  update-user-activity --activity=-
  update-user-activity --clear

Usage: pearing-cli update-user-activity --activity <ACTIVITY> [TARGET_USERNAME]
       pearing-cli update-user-activity --clear [TARGET_USERNAME]

Arguments:
  [TARGET_USERNAME]
          Existing username to update. Defaults to the authenticated user

Options:
      --activity <ACTIVITY>
          Current activity text. Pass '-' to read from stdin

      --clear
          Clear the current activity

  -h, --help
          Print help (see a summary with '-h')
